The Emperor

major Arcana·#4

Upright Meaning

AuthorityStructureControlFatherhoodStability

The Emperor sits on a stone throne carved with ram's heads — the symbol of Aries, Mars, and martial authority. He holds an ankh in one hand (life) and an orb in the other (dominion). Behind him, the landscape is barren mountains — his domain is structure, order, and law, not the fertile gardens of the Empress. He represents the principle of civilization itself: the imposition of order upon chaos.

Reversed Meaning

TyrannyRigidityDominationInflexibility

Reversed, The Emperor's authority becomes authoritarianism. Structure becomes rigidity. Control becomes domination. This position warns against excessive need for control — either your own or someone else's. It can indicate a father figure or authority who has overstepped, or your own tendency to grip too tightly when you should be adapting.
